U.S. Rep. Tom Graves will speak with constituents later this month in Forsyth County.

The Aug. 31 visit is among the last on the Ranger Republican’s summer town hall tour of District 9.

Forsyth residents, as well as those of neighboring communities, are welcome to attend.

Graves is expected to begin by talking about issues and his position on recent congressional votes.

He will also take a short survey before opening the floor to the audience for questions.

The meeting is set for 6 p.m. Aug. 31 in the commissioners meeting room at the Forsyth County Administration Build-ing, 110 E. Main St. in Cumming. 

Those unable to attend the local session can catch up with Graves at the Sept. 1 meetings in Lumpkin and Fannin counties.
